My rating: 5 of 5 stars
Cute book and the art is so sweet! Joe is such a sweetheart, very unconcerned with anything at his new school other than learning to read. He has quite and adventure trying to find someone to help him read. The part where he gets to the salon and decides it’s the right place because they are ladies reading under helmets, that was funny and accurate! It made me chuckle they way Bea is drawn, chasing after Joe. I love that mom and Mrs. Richey explain to Joe that learning to read takes time, just like riding a bike or swimming, you have to learn and practice.
